Buffett follows the Benjamin Graham school of value investing, which tries to find securities whose rates are unjustifiably low based upon their intrinsic worth.

A few of the factors Buffett considers are company efficiency, company debt, and profit margins. Other factors to consider for worth investors like Buffett include whether companies are public, how reliant they are on commodities, and how cheap they are. Warren Buffett was born in Omaha in 1930. He developed an interest in business world and investing at an early age consisting of in the stock market. warren buffett written quote.

Buffett later on went to the Columbia Business School where he earned his graduate degree in economics. Buffett began his profession as an investment salesperson in the early 1950s but formed Buffett Associates in 1956. Less than ten years later on, in 1965, he was in control of Berkshire Hathaway. Buffett, however, isn't interested in the supply and demand complexities of the stock exchange. In reality, he's not actually worried with the activities of the stock market at all. This is the implication in his well-known paraphrase of a Benjamin Graham quote: "In the brief run, the market is a voting device but in the long run it is a weighing maker." He looks at each business as a whole, so he selects stocks solely based upon their general capacity as a business.

When Buffett purchases a business, he isn't worried about whether the market will ultimately acknowledge its worth. He is interested in how well that company can generate income as a company. The debt-to-equity ratio (D/E) is another key particular Buffett considers carefully. Buffett prefers to see a percentage of debt so that revenues development is being produced from shareholders' equity instead of borrowed money. The D/E ratio is computed as follows: Debt-to-Equity Ratio = Overall Liabilities Shareholders' Equity This ratio reveals the proportion of equity and debt the company uses to fund its assets, and the greater the ratio, the more debtrather than equityis financing the business.

For a more stringent test, investors often use only long-term debt instead of total liabilities in the estimation above. A business's success depends not only on having a great earnings margin, however also on consistently increasing it. This margin is determined by dividing earnings by net sales (warren buffett written quote). For a great indicator of historical earnings margins, financiers should look back at least 5 years.

Buffett generally considers only companies that have actually been around for a minimum of 10 years. As a result, most of the innovation companies that have actually had their initial public offering (IPOs) in the past decade wouldn't get on Buffett's radar. He's said he doesn't comprehend the mechanics behind a lot of today's technology business, and only purchases a service that he totally understands.
